Waking Death – David Garneau, Don Gill, Faye Heavyshield, Mary Kavanagh, Annie Martin, Bryce Singer, Kasia Sosnowski, and Adrian Stimson (Curated by the Waking Death Collective)

Join us for this exciting exhibition and event series opening. There will be art, there will be performance, there will be refreshments, there will be … feelings!

Waking Death is an invitational exhibition organized by the Waking Death Collective with the collaboration of the Allied Arts Council of Lethbridge. Bringing together new and existing works by diverse artists in a range of media, the exhibition explores themes of death, dying and grief through a polyphonic array of voices.  The Waking Death Collective is Annie Martin, Shanell Papp, and Mia Van Leeuwen).

 As part of the opening event at Casa on September 9th, there will be a Waking Death Parade Procession to kick off the event series! Dreamt up and facilitated by Mia van Leeuwen in collaboration with Shanell Papp, Annie Martin, Julia Wasilewski, Jaime Johnson, Kathy Zaborsky, Gabrielle Houle, Nicola Elson, Oluseyi Dada, Anastasia Siceac — and an amazing team of volunteers — we will bring artistic ceremony and song to this event series with a parade open to the public to join!
